Blaine's Climate Puts Real Stress on Siding

Blaine sits right on the water at the northwest corner of Whatcom County, and that location comes with a specific set of siding problems most inland contractors rarely think about. Homes here take on salt-laden air blowing in off Semiahmoo Bay and Drayton Harbor, near-constant driving rain off the Strait of Georgia, and a moss and mildew season that can run eight or nine months out of the year in shaded, north-facing exposures. Add in wind-driven rain events that push water sideways into seams and laps, and you have a climate that finds every weakness in a siding system faster than almost anywhere else in the Pacific Northwest.

Salt air is corrosive to metal fasteners, flashing, and trim if the wrong materials or installation details are used. Constant moisture exposure is what breaks down products that rely on paint film or edge sealant to stay watertight. And moss doesn't just look bad — its root structure holds water against a wall assembly and, on the wrong substrate, accelerates rot from the outside in. Any siding installed in Blaine needs to be selected and installed with all three of these factors in mind, not just for how it looks the day it goes up.

What "Correct" Siding Installation Actually Involves

A lot of siding failures aren't material failures — they're installation failures. The product gets blamed, but the real problem is a shortcut taken underneath it. In a marine climate like Blaine's, the details behind the siding matter as much as the siding itself.

Weather-Resistive Barrier and Flashing

Every wall needs a continuous weather-resistive barrier (WRB) installed with proper shingle-lap sequencing, so water is always directed outward and down, never trapped behind the cladding. Window and door openings need head flashing, and every horizontal trim transition needs kick-out flashing or a drip cap to break water's path before it can wick behind the siding. This is invisible work once the job is done, but it's the single biggest factor in whether a wall stays dry for decades or develops hidden rot in five years.

Fasteners and Clearances

In a salt-air environment, fastener choice matters. Corrosion-resistant nails or screws, installed at the manufacturer's specified pattern and depth, prevent streaking and loosening over time. Siding also needs proper clearance from grade, roof lines, decks, and hardscape — generally a minimum gap so splash-back and standing moisture can't wick continuously into the bottom courses.

Joints, Caulking, and Field-Painting

Butt joints, corners, and penetrations (hose bibs, vents, light fixtures) are where most siding leaks start. These need to be sealed with a high-quality, paintable exterior sealant rated for the product, not general-purpose caulk that shrinks and cracks within a couple of seasons. Any field-cut edges on fiber cement need to be sealed or back-primed per the manufacturer's instructions so raw material isn't left exposed to moisture.

Why We Install Only James Hardie Fiber Cement

Bellingham Exterior installs James Hardie fiber cement siding exclusively. We don't install vinyl, LP SmartSide, Cemplank, Allura, or primed wood siding, and that's a deliberate standard, not a limitation of what we're capable of installing. Here's the honest reasoning:

Vinyl siding is affordable and low-maintenance in mild weather, but it's a thin material that relies on interlocking panels rather than a sealed, monolithic surface. Wind-driven rain in an exposed Blaine location can drive moisture behind vinyl panels over time, and the material itself can warp, fade, or crack in temperature swings and impact events. Wood siding — cedar or primed spruce — looks great when new, but it's organic material in a climate built to grow moss and mildew on organic material; it needs recurring painting, caulking, and moss treatment to hold up, and skipped maintenance shows up fast as rot. Other fiber cement brands like LP SmartSide (engineered wood, not cement) and generic fiber cement lines like Cemplank or Allura may perform reasonably, but we've standardized on one product line so our crews are deeply proficient in one installation system, one flashing detail set, and one warranty structure — rather than splitting expertise across several products with different failure modes.

James Hardie fiber cement is non-combustible, dimensionally stable in wet-dry cycling, and available in HZ5 formulations engineered for climate zones with high moisture exposure — which describes Whatcom County's coastline well. The factory-applied ColorPlus finish is baked on under controlled conditions, which holds color and resists the moss and mildew that plague field-painted materials, and it comes with a strong transferable warranty when installed to spec. That "installed to spec" part is why we control the whole job rather than mixing products — the warranty and the performance are only as good as the installation underneath them.

Our Installation Process in Blaine

  1. On-site assessment — we walk the exterior, check existing siding and sheathing condition, note wind/water exposure on each elevation, and look for existing moisture damage before quoting anything.
  2. Tear-off and substrate check — old siding comes off and we inspect sheathing for soft spots or hidden rot, especially around windows, decks, and roof-to-wall intersections common trouble spots in wet climates.
  3. WRB and flashing install — a continuous weather-resistive barrier goes on with correctly lapped seams, followed by window, door, and penetration flashing.
  4. Hardie panel or lap installation — installed per manufacturer fastening schedule and clearance requirements, with attention to butt joint placement and corner details.
  5. Sealing and trim — joints and penetrations sealed with appropriate exterior sealant; trim and caulking finished to shed water at every transition.
  6. Final walkthrough — we review the finished job with the homeowner and confirm everything meets both our install standards and Hardie's warranty requirements.

Signs Your Blaine Home May Need New Siding

  • Persistent moss or dark streaking that returns within weeks of cleaning
  • Soft or spongy spots when pressing on siding near the bottom courses or under windows
  • Paint that's peeling, bubbling, or won't hold on wood or engineered wood siding
  • Visible warping, cracking, or panel gaps, especially on walls facing prevailing wind and rain
  • Rising energy bills that suggest the wall assembly behind the siding is no longer performing
  • Interior signs — musty smell, staining, or soft drywall near exterior walls

How long does a full siding replacement typically take?

Most single-family homes take one to two weeks from tear-off to final trim, depending on size, substrate condition, and weather delays. Homes needing sheathing repair after tear-off can take longer, since that work has to be completed and inspected before new siding goes on.

What should I ask a contractor before hiring them for siding work in Whatcom County?

Ask whether they carry current Washington contractor licensing and liability insurance, whether they specialize in one siding system or install several, and how they handle flashing and moisture barrier details specifically for coastal exposure. Ask for a written scope that spells out tear-off, substrate repair contingencies, and warranty terms rather than a vague lump-sum quote.

Why do you only install James Hardie instead of offering multiple siding brands?

Focusing on one product line means our crews are deeply trained in one flashing and fastening system rather than spread across several with different installation requirements. We chose Hardie because its HZ5 product lines and factory finish are engineered for wet, coastal climates like Blaine's, and its warranty depends on installation being done to spec, which we can control consistently.

What's the difference between Hardie's HZ5 and HZ10 product zones?

James Hardie engineers certain siding lines for specific climate zones based on moisture and temperature exposure, and coastal Pacific Northwest locations like Blaine typically fall into the wetter HZ5 zone designation. Using the zone-appropriate product matters for how the material performs against sustained moisture exposure over its lifespan.

Does salt air from Semiahmoo Bay or Drayton Harbor actually affect siding differently than inland Bellingham?

Yes — homes closer to the water take on more airborne salt and more direct wind-driven rain, which accelerates corrosion on unprotected metal fasteners and trim and puts more stress on caulked joints. Waterfront and near-waterfront lots generally need more attention to fastener choice and sealant detailing than homes further inland.
